Vanloads of Somalians driven to the polls in Ohio
patriotupdate.com ^

Posted on 10/27/2012 4:47:31 PM PDT by tsowellfan

Two volunteer poll workers at an Ohio voting station told Human Events that they observed van loads of Ohio residents born in Somalia — the state is home to the second-largest Somali population in the United States — being driven to the voting station and guided by Democratic interpreters on the voting process. No Republican interpreters were present, according to these volunteers...
